SPIED: Ford's Toyota Fortuner-fighter

Ford is to expand its Ranger bakkie line-up with a new SUV later in 2014 - one version of which will be a seven-seater.

GALLERY: 2014 Ford Ranger SUV

Spy photographs show the car in production metal for the first time though it’s camouflaged in confusing black/white paint.

'AN SUV BENCHMARK'

Ford replaced the Ranger bakkie’s leaf-spring rear suspension with a coil-sprung set-up.

According to Ford, the new model will "set an SUV benchmark" while delivering "great off-road capability and toughness".

The Ranger SUV will be unveiled in the second half of 2014. Unfortunately, Ford has no plans to sell it in South Africa.
